UK Households Have Experienced The Biggest Immediate Income Shock Since The Mid-1970s

[IMG][/IMG] Policy response has massively boosted poorest households' incomes, but further shocks lie ahead. The covid-induced crisis has caused typical working-age household incomes to fall 4.5 per cent between the pre-crisis period and May this year, despite the critical policy support that has cushioned the shock for millions of households, according to the Resolution Foundation's Living Standards Audit published on Tuesday 21st July 2020.
